Industry Restraints
Despite the positive growth trajectory, the Floor Cleaning Equipment Market faces several restraints. One primary concern is the high initial investment required for advanced cleaning equipment. Many small and medium-sized enterprises struggle to allocate sufficient budgets for these purchases, potentially limiting their ability to adopt modern cleaning technologies. Furthermore, the maintenance costs associated with sophisticated equipment can also be a deterrent for businesses operating on tight budgets.
Another significant restraint is the presence of a skilled labor shortage in the cleaning industry. The effective operation and maintenance of advanced floor cleaning equipment often require specialized training, which is not always readily available. Additionally, the market is competitive, with numerous established players and new entrants vying for market share. This competition could lead to price wars, which may negatively impact profit margins and hinder investment in research and development. Lastly, fluctuating raw material prices can affect production costs, ultimately impacting the pricing and availability of cleaning equipment in the market.

Asia Pacific
In the Asia Pacific region, the floor cleaning equipment market is experiencing rapid growth, particularly in countries like China, Japan, and South Korea. China stands out as a significant contributor due to its expanding industrial base and urbanization, which drives demand for efficient cleaning solutions in commercial and residential spaces. Japan, known for its technological advancements, favors automated cleaning systems that enhance efficiency and precision. South Korea is also witnessing a surge in demand for innovative cleaning solutions, propelled by heightened consumer awareness regarding cleanliness and hygiene. The overall growth in this region is further fueled by increasing investments in infrastructure and commercial developments.
Europe
Europe showcases a diverse floor cleaning equipment market, with major contributors including the UK, Germany, and France. Germany emerges as a leader in this sector, benefiting from a robust industrial sector and a strong emphasis on sustainability and energy-efficient products. The UK exhibits a growing market fueled by an increase in retail and commercial facilities seeking advanced cleaning solutions to maintain stringent hygiene standards. France follows closely, with an emphasis on technological innovations in cleaning equipment and a trend towards professional cleaning services. The region's regulatory framework supporting environmental sustainability also fosters the adoption of eco-friendly cleaning solutions, thereby stimulating market growth.
The product segment of the floor cleaning equipment market can be divided into several key categories including vacuum cleaners, sweepers, scrubbers, steam cleaners, and mops. Among these, vacuum cleaners hold a significant share, driven by their versatility in both residential and commercial spaces. Within this category, robotic vacuum cleaners have seen a surge in popularity, largely due to advancements in technology and automation. Sweepers and scrubbers are also expected to witness substantial growth, particularly in industrial environments where maintaining cleanliness is critical. Steam cleaners are gaining traction due to their environmentally friendly cleaning capabilities, marking them as a product category to watch closely.
Application Segment
In terms of application, the market for floor cleaning equipment is segmented into residential, commercial, and industrial uses. The commercial application segment is anticipated to exhibit the largest market size, fueled by increasing investments in commercial infrastructure and a rising emphasis on hygiene in spaces such as offices, retail outlets, and hospitals. The adoption of automated cleaning solutions in these settings is further enhancing this segment's growth. The industrial application segment, particularly in manufacturing facilities and warehouses, is also poised for rapid growth as companies prioritize operational efficiency and worker safety by ensuring clean environments.
Distribution Channel Segment
The distribution channel segment comprises offline and online channels. Offline channels, including retail stores and distribution networks, have traditionally dominated the market but are seeing increased competition from online channels. E-commerce platforms are rapidly gaining favor due to the convenience they offer, alongside an extensive range of options and competitive pricing. This shift towards online purchasing is expected to drive growth in that channel, particularly as consumers become more comfortable with digital transactions. Both segments will play crucial roles in reaching diverse customers, but online channels are likely to emerge as the fastest-growing distribution method going forward.
